  • Abstract
    A Calvet type calorimeter was used for measurement of partial and integral enthalpies of mixing of Ag–Ga–Sn alloys. The Ag–Ga binary alloys have been studied with 0 < xAg < 0.79 composition and in the 803–1073 K temperature range. The mixing enthalpies at 803 K of Ga–Sn binary alloys have been determined for xSn < 0.35. The Ag–Ga–Sn ternary liquid alloys have been investigated at 803 K along the following sections: xAg/xGa = 1/3, xAg/xGa = 0.36/0.64, xAg/xGa = 1/1, xGa/xSn = 1/3, xGa/xSn = 1/1, xGa/xSn = 0.65/0.35 and xGa/xSn = 3/1. Experimental data were used to obtain the binary interaction parameters by using the Redlich–Kister polynomial for the Ag–Ga binary system, while the Redlich–Kister–Muggianu method was used to determine the ternary interaction parameters for the Ag–Ga–Sn system. The experimental values and the fitted curves were compared with those predicted from the Muggianu and Toop methods.
